Council to consider approval of a Resolution authorizing the acquisition of properties for <br />drainage improvements in the Little Cedar Bayou Watershed. <br /> <br />Director of Planning Doug Kneupper read the summary and recommendation and answered <br />Council's questions. <br /> <br />Assistant City Attorney read: RESOLUTION 2003-16 - A RESOLUTION AUTHORIZING <br />THE ACQUISITION OF TRACTS OF LAND FOR DRAINAGE AND FLOOD <br />CONTROL PURPOSES IN THE CITY OF LA PORTE; FINDING COMPLIANCE WITH <br />THE OPEN MEETINGS LAW;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E HEREOF. <br /> <br />Motion was made by Councilmember Meismer to approve Resolution 2003-16 as presented <br />bv Mr. Kneupper. Second by Councilmember Griffiths. The motion carried <br /> <br />Ayes: Mosteit, Griffiths, Young, Engelken, Beasley, Warren, Meismer, Ebow and Malone <br />Nays: None <br />Abstain: None <br /> <br />10. Council to consider approval of a Resolution providing for the multi-jurisdictional <br />development of a Comprehensive Hazard Mitigation Plan with Harris County. <br /> <br />Director of Emergency Services Joe Sease presented summary and recommendations and <br />answered Council's questions. <br /> <br />Assistant City Attorney read: RESOLUTION 2003-17 - A JOINT RESOLUTION OF THE <br />COMMISSIONERS COURT OF HARRIS COUNTY, TEXAS, AND THE CITY <br />CO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LA PORTE, TEXAS, PROVIDING FOR THE ADOPTION <br />OF AN INTERJURISDICTIONAL COMPREHENSIVE ALL HAZARD MITIGATION <br />PLAN. <br /> <br />Motion was made bv Councilmember Youne: to aoorove Resolution 2003-17 as presented bv <br />Mr. Sease. Second by Councilmember Ebow. The motion carried. <br /> <br />Ayes: Mosteit, Griffiths, Young, Engelken, Beasley, Warren, Meismer, Ebow and Malone <br />Nays: None <br />Abstain: None <br /> <br />11.
